    North Bergen is a safe neighborhood, it was quiet at night.

    North Bergen is a safe neighborhood, it was quiet at night. Living in NJ is the best way to visit New York while having a car. Parkings are tough and expensive in NYC downtown. While you can live here paying less and maybe having a free parking for your car. you'll have shuttles coming and going throughout the day which can take you to Times Square for around (3-7$). but if you're visiting just for NY and you want to enjoy every moment of your day, I'll recommend not renting a car and living in the downtown area while everything is within walking distance from you.

    If you want to go to NYC from North Bergen the best option...

    If you want to go to NYC from North Bergen the best option is taking public transit, about $3.50-5.10 one way. Due to the bridge tolls an Uber will cost about $35-60 one way. Getting TO New York via bus was very easy HOWEVER, taking the bus from the Port Authority Bus Station was extremely confusing. You have to select a bus (even though you usually have multiple buses that can take you to the same stop) and you also have to pick zones but they can change depending on the bus and not the location of your bus stop.

    -Very friendly and patient staff. -To go to NYC there is an alternative to the hotel's shuttle bus and it's an NJ transit pass discount ticket: you pay 29,50 Dollars instead of 35 and you get 10 rides. So instead of 3,5 Dollars or more, you only pay 2,95 per ride, which saves a bit of money. The pass can be purchased only at any of the Port Authority (NYC) ticket machines. The NYC metro card is not valid in New Jersey.
